Gold IRA Compared to a 401(k): Which Is Right for You?
Planning for retirement involves carefully determining the right investment strategies. Two popular options often analyzed are the Gold IRA Gold IRA vs physical gold and the traditional 401(k). While both offer advantages for long-term growth, they differ significantly in their format. A Gold IRA, as its name implies, invests primarily in physical gold, while a 401(k) allows for a wider range of assets, including stocks, bonds, and mutual funds.

Exploring the Potential of a Gold IRA: Pros & Cons
A Gold Individual Retirement Account (IRA) presents a unique avenue for investors seeking to diversify their portfolios. By investing in physical gold within an IRA, individuals can possibly benefit from its historical value as a reserve asset. However, it's essential to meticulously evaluate both the advantages and disadvantages before making a decision.
- Amongst the strengths of a Gold IRA is its potential to shield your assets from market volatility.
- Gold has historically served as a reliable safe haven asset during times of financial turmoil.
Conversely, there are some limitations to keep in mind. One major factor is the potential forstorage costs. Additionally, liquidity can be a issue with Gold IRAs, as selling your gold holdings may involve delay.

Maximizing Your Retirement Savings: The Benefits of a Gold IRA
Planning for a comfortable retirement requires careful financial planning. Traditional savings accounts and assets may be impacted by inflation and market volatility. A strategic tool to diversify your portfolio and protect your nest egg is a Gold IRA. This type of retirement account allows you to invest in physical gold, offering a tangible asset that has historically held its value over time.
- Advantages of a Gold IRA include:
- Hedge Against Inflation:
Gold is known as a stable asset during times of economic uncertainty, potentially buffering the effects of inflation on your savings. - Diversification:
Adding gold to your portfolio can reduce overall risk by counterbalancing the volatility of traditional assets like stocks and bonds. - Real Value:
Unlike paper assets, gold is a physical commodity that you truly possess. This provides a sense of security and assurance in your investments.
